Multisignature refers to the process where multiple keys are required to provide digital signatures before executing a transaction. In the Bitpie wallet, this means that the transfer of funds must be approved by multiple authorized individuals or devices, which enhances the security of transactions and prevents tampering or mistakes by a single party.

How multisignature works

  • Set a thresholdUsers can choose how many keys are required to complete a transaction. For example, a 3-of-2 multisig means that 2 signatures out of 3 keys are needed to execute it.
  • distribution of powerBy assigning keys to different users, the risk of being attacked can be effectively reduced while enhancing the security of funds.
  • Enhance transparencyMultisignature transactions are all public on the blockchain, making them easy to audit and inspect.
  • Advantages of multi-signature

  • Enhance security
  • The multi-signature mechanism can significantly enhance the security of the Bitpie wallet. For large enterprises or institutional users, money often involves many stakeholders, and a single-key mechanism can easily become a target for attacks. By using multi-signature, it is possible to effectively defend against hacker attacks and internal violations.

  • Prevent single point of failure
  • If a user's private key is lost or stolen, a single point of failure will prevent the user from accessing their funds. Through the use of multi-signature methods, even if a single key is lost, the other keys remain available, which greatly reduces uncontrollable risks.

  • Flexible permission assignment
  • The multi-signature feature of the Bitpie wallet allows users to set corresponding permission rules according to their needs. For example, specific members can be granted the authority to transfer assets, while others may only have viewing and auditing rights. This is especially important in environments managed by multiple people.

  • Business process compliance
  • Many businesses need to comply with regulatory requirements when conducting financial transactions. Multi-signature transactions can effectively record participants, ensure transparency in business processes, and meet regulatory requirements.

  • Enhance transaction transparency
  • All multi-signature transactions are recorded on the blockchain, allowing users to review transaction history at any time and preventing the covert transfer of assets. This transparency helps to enhance user trust.

    Disadvantages of multi-signature

  • Operational complexity
  • Although multisignature enhances security, it also increases operational complexity. Users need to manage multiple keys, which may be confusing for ordinary users and requires corresponding learning and adaptation.

  • Slow transaction speed
  • Multi-signature transactions usually require approval from multiple keys, which may cause delays during the transfer of funds. For users who need to cash out for daily transactions, such unexpected delays might cause inconvenience.

  • Uneven risk allocation
  • When multiple participants hold keys, fairly distributing responsibility and risk also becomes more complex. If one of the key holders fails to act prudently, other users may suffer joint losses.

  • Continuous management is required.
  • Multisignature is not only something to pay attention to during the initial setup; it also requires regular management of key security and permissions in the future. If a key member leaves the organization, the information of key holders must be updated promptly to avoid security risks.

  • May lead to a user trust crisis
  • In certain situations, disagreements over fund management may arise among participants, especially in large transactions. A crisis of trust could lead to unnecessary disputes, affecting the overall business.

    4. Tips for Enhancing Productivity When Using Bitpie Wallet Multisig

  • Regularly train team members
  • In order to better manage the Bitpie wallet's multi-signature feature, it is essential to provide regular training for the team. This ensures that every member is proficient in operating the multi-signature process, reducing errors caused by unfamiliarity with the procedures.

  • Establish clear permission management
  • In a corporate environment, it is recommended to establish a detailed list of permission assignments, clearly defining the responsibilities and authorities of each team member to ensure that every transaction undergoes a proper review process.

  • Use multi-factor authentication (MFA)
  • In conjunction with the multi-signature mechanism, it is recommended to implement multi-factor authentication to further strengthen the security of the wallet. Even if the key is stolen, hackers would still need to obtain additional identity verification in order to complete a transfer.

  • Regularly audit transaction records
  • Establish regular audit procedures to identify and address potential security issues. Designate dedicated personnel to be responsible for audits, ensuring transparency and reducing risks.

  • Backup key
  • Ensure that all keys are backed up regularly to prevent loss. Keys can be stored in a secure location, and access should be restricted to trusted personnel only.
